Specifications
Brand
NexperiaProduct Type
Diode
Mount Type
Through Hole
Package Type
DO-35
Maximum Continuous Forward Current If
250mA
Peak Reverse Repetitive Voltage Vrrm
250V
Diode Configuration
Single
Series
BAV21
Rectifier Type
General Purpose
Pin Count
2
Peak Reverse Current Ir
100nA
Minimum Operating Temperature
-65°C
Peak Non-Repetitive Forward Surge Current Ifsm
9A
Maximum Forward Voltage Vf
1.25V
Peak Reverse Recovery Time trr
50ns
Maximum Operating Temperature
175°C
Height
1.85mm
Length
4.25mm
Standards/Approvals
No
Automotive Standard
No
Country of Origin
China
Product details
Small Signal Switching Diodes, Nexperia
Features
Supports customised high density circuit designs
Low-leakage and high-voltage types available
High switching speeds
Low capacitance
